The surroundings

The lake sits close to town with a road right up to it — easy to reach, but hard-fished and exposed to nutrient runoff from the buildings and fields all around.

Shallow throughout (max 4 m), with reeds and vegetation over large areas — water that warms fast in spring.

Permits & rules

Fishing permit required — Trollbutjärnen FVOF. Day permit ~60 kr · annual permit ~300 kr.

  •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
  •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
